This position is responsible for the processing of mortgage releases/satisfactions, performing mortgage modifications, recasts, balloons, ARMs, SCRA processes, document recording, and deceased borrower notifications. This role will also be responsible for working with document custodians and tracking collateral documentation.

Responsibilities

  • Update and maintain position procedures.
  • Daily:
    • PIF Tracking
    • Image PIF files to vendor by 11:00 AM
  • Process daily, weekly, and monthly reports.
  • Research Fannie Mae, Freddie Mac, Ginnie Mae, and FHLB regulations by regularly utilizing their servicing guides.
  • Update modification documents as regulations change.
  • Process loan modifications, assumptions, and recast requests and verify modification keying in MSP.
  • Order modified title policies through the vendor as required.
  • Process satisfactions through the vendor for all Mortgage Servicing loans paid-in-full.
  • Work with legal department compulsory legal processes.
  • Record documents in Simplifile E-Recording system or directly with county recorders.
  • Update MSP and take record of Promissory Notes when received from doc custodians.
  • Review and follow up on US Bank, Bank of New York Mellon, NTC, and Simplifile notifications.
  • Serve as a resource to the Manager and research processes and procedures to find efficiencies within the system.
  • This position is required to maintain a working knowledge of all Bell Bank, State, Federal and investor guidelines in order to ensure compliance with rules and regulations.
